Element has an opportunity for a Senior Facilities Project Manager. In this role, you will be a member of the Mobility Division's Leadership Team who are responsible for leading a group of labs that support the automotive markets as well as battery markets. You will work with the members of the Mobility Team to develop plans, seek approval, and execute projects On Quality, On Time, and On Budget. This role reports to the VP of the Mobility division.


  • Work with the Mobility Leadership Team to prepare Capital Expenditures and Plans for approval.
  • Complete sophisticated analyses and make data-based recommendations
  • Prepare presentations
  • Lead Project Execution in collaboration with stakeholders across the business
  • Negotiate with outside vendors
  • Obtain multiple bids from contractors
  • Work with contractors on commercial projects
  • Track and prepare project updates
  • Present project updates to the divisional as well as business unit leadership

  • A bachelor's degree in project management, business management, or a similar field, with an MBA preferred
  • A minimum of 3 year's experience as a PMO analyst, project manager, or a similar role
  • Excellent knowledge of project management strategies, processes, and tools
  • Experience working with contractors on commercial projects
  • Ability to analyze a range of complex data and make decisions based on analytical findings
  • Great computer skills and knowledge of PMO software tools, such as MS PowerPoint, MS Excel, Power BI, MS Project and MS Access
  • Strong program coordination and administration abilities.
  • Good critical thinking and problem-solving skills
  • Solid communication and interpersonal skills
  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ced environment and work well under pressure

Element is one of the fastest growing testing, inspection and certification businesses in the world. Globally we have more than 9,000 brilliant minds operating from 270 sites across 30 countries. Together we share an ambitious purpose to ‘Make tomorrow safer than today’.

When failure in use is not an option, we help customers make certain that their products, materials, processes and services are safe, compliant and fit for purpose. From early R&D, through complex regulatory approvals and into production, our global laboratory network of scientists, engineers, and technologists support customers to achieve assurance over product quality, sustainable outcomes, and market access.
